ROLE PLAYERS 2018 - Mohini Daljeet Singh


Mohini Daljeet Singh

CHIEF EXECUTIVE
MAX INDIA FOUNDATION

Mohini Daljeet Singh, a social worker and an educationist, is widely travelled. She started her social service journey by volunteering as a student with Mother Teresa's Home "Prem Niwas", in Lucknow, where she learnt her lessons of compassion and selfless social giving.

An army daughter and army wife, she has spent more than three decades on "hands-on" social and welfare work to benefit army families in the health, education and personal counselling areas.

As Founding CEO of Max India Foundation, Mohini Daljeet Singh has worked for the underprivileged on the health platform benefitting over 30 Lakh beneficiaries at 772 locations and partnering with 441 NGOs. The Foundation has adopted one village in Punjab and two villages in Uttarakhand in 2015 for intervention on the issue of health and hygiene.

Mohini has represented Max India Foundation as a panellist and anchor at various CSR platforms in India and abroad, including that of CII, ASSOCHAM, PHD Chamber of Commerce, CSR Live week, BRICS CCI centre for CSR and IICA.

Under her stewardship as the founding CEO, Max India Foundation has won several awards including the Golden Peacock Award for CSR for four consecutive years. Recently on 29 Jan she received the award for Asia's Greatest CSR Brand at Singapore on behalf of Max India Foundation. She has been awarded 'Best Women Leadership Excellence award in CSR' at The South Asian Partnership Summit & Business Awards held in Colombo and the Hari Chand Award for Corporate Citizen of the year 2015 by Ludhiana Management Association and CSR person of the year by India CSR in 2016.
